The Raw Materials Academy (“RMA”) and the Advanced Materials Academy (“AMA”), being two of EIT RawMaterials’ flagship projects funded by the European Commission, are developing a portfolio of self-paced, online training content to upskill and reskill the raw and advanced materials workforce. To deliver this content at scale, EIT RawMaterials is establishing a Learning Management System (“LMS”) that will serve as the central hosting environment for the Academies' own training modules and as the reporting backbone for the learners trained through them.
The primary purpose of the LMS is to host training content developed by the Academies, including both technical learning journeys and self-paced learning modules aimed at broad audiences across the raw and advanced materials value chain. A second, equally important purpose is interoperability.
The combined ambition of the Academies is to train at least 300,000 learners (100,000 RMA, 200,000 AMA), drawn from both our own hosted courses and our third-party providers.

- Sprint planning
5.1 The LMS shall be implemented iteratively and incrementally in sprints. Within each sprint a predefined number of tasks (“User Stories”) shall be successfully completed. User stories are defined on the basis of the service description (section 2.1.3) and the contractor’s draft product backlog which is part of its tender (section 2.1.4).
5.2 The parties agree on the sprints, the timeline, and the payment schedule (“Project Plan”) within one week after the effective date (“Planning Phase”). The project plan shall be based on the contractor’s tender (section 2.1.4), its draft product backlog and the initial sprint planning prepared during the procurement procedure according to the Service Description (section 2.1.3). The number and the content of sprints might be adjusted by the parties during the checkpoint phase as defined in the Service Description (section 2.1.3).

5.3 Each sprint shall consist of sprint planning, necessary implementation work (e.g. customization, configuration, development, testing, rollout), a sprint review and a sprint retrospective.
5.4 As part of the sprint planning the parties shall in due time before the actual implementation work determine and document the goal of each sprint and which product backlog items are to be implemented by the contractor (in whole or in part) during that specific sprint as the work result ("Increment").
5.5 The contractor shall implement each increment in accordance with the Agreement, in particular in accordance with the sprint planning and shall hand it over to EIT RawMaterials for approval in electronic or physical form (data carrier).
5.6 At the end of each sprint, there must be an increment of the LMS that is subject to a review by EIT RawMaterials. EIT RawMaterials decides on the achievement/non-achievement of a sprint goal in the sprint review and, if necessary, on reprioritization. It must be possible for the first increment of the LMS to run separately and independently of the increments to be implemented later. The approval of an increment shall not constitute a (partial or interim) acceptance in accordance with section 640 (1) BGB. Defects identified in the sprint review phase shall be resolved by the contractor at its own expense with the next sprint, if not agreed otherwise.
5.7 EIT RawMaterials may at any time request that new user stories are added to the product backlog and/or that the content of the user stories existing in the product backlog are changed, reduced or extended, reprioritized, removed or replaced or exchanged by new ones. The contractor may also propose changes to the product backlog to EIT RawMaterials at any time. Non-substantial changes or extensions of user stories and exchanges of user stories within the agreed total of person hours shall be implemented by the contractor with no entitlement to additional remuneration.
The product backlog shall be updated by the contractor on an ongoing basis, but at least at the end of each sprint, taking into account the clarifications, exchanges and changes requested by EIT RawMaterials.

- Availability
12.1 The LMS shall be available for an average of 99,8% per calendar quarter (“Availability Time”).
12.2 The Availability Time is calculated based on a quarterly aggregate time (days in the respective quarter x 24 hours x 60 minutes) (“Total Time”) deducted by the Downtime in minutes (as defined in section 12.3) divided by the Total Time multiped by 100 percent according to the following formula:
(Total Time – Downtime) x 100% Total Time
12.3 “Downtime” is the time during which the LMS is not available. However, force majeure or other events beyond the contractor's control that were not foreseeable and could not have been prevented by the contractor shall not be considered as Downtime.
12.4 Scheduled maintenance work that causes Downtimes shall, if reasonably possible, be conducted during night times or on weekends and shall be announced to EIT RawMaterials seven days in advance. In urgent cases, where immediate actions are necessary, e.g. in order to implement important security patches, the contractor may shorten such period reasonably or begin with the scheduled maintenance without prior notice, provided, however, that EIT RawMaterials shall be informed as soon as possible. In any case Downtimes shall be kept as minimal as possible.
12.5 The contractor shall use virus scanners and firewalls and implement further technical and organizational measures to prevent or stop unauthorized access to the data and the transmission of harmful data, especially viruses, as far as possible with reasonable economic and technical effort.

- Rights to Work Results, Software
13.1 The parties agree that all work results created individually by the contractor for EIT RawMaterials, irrespective of whether they may be the subject of industrial property rights ("Work Results"), shall belong exclusively to EIT RawMaterials. EIT RawMaterials shall be enabled in the most comprehensive manner to exploit the work results in the original or modified form in any respect, whether itself or by transferring the rights to it to third parties.
13.2 If the transfer of rights according to section 13.1 is not possible the contractor grants EIT RawMaterials an exclusive, irrevocable, transferable right of use to the work results, unlimited in time, place and content, for all known and unknown types of use. The rights of use include, but are not limited to, the right of reproduction, the right of distribution, the right of exhibition, the right of lecture and demonstration, the right of making the work results publicly available, the right of broadcasting, the right of reproduction by means of visual and audio media, the right of radio broadcasting and the right of granting public access. The contractor allows EIT RawMaterials to modify the work results, to integrate them partially or entirely into other works, to translate them and to change the title of the work results. EIT RawMaterials is permitted to transfer the rights to the work results in part or in whole to third parties and to grant sublicenses.
13.3 If the work results may be subject to a registered intellectual property right, the contractor shall transfer them to EIT RawMaterials in advance. EIT RawMaterials shall be entitled but not obliged to file such applications. The contractor shall not be entitled to file applications for intellectual property rights in its own name.
13.4 EIT RawMaterials shall be entitled to assert claims in its own name out of court and/or in court in the event of infringements of the rights to the work results by third parties. The contractor shall be obliged to provide EIT RawMaterials with all documents and information required for the enforcement of the rights and to make any necessary declarations, including affidavits, if required.
13.5 The granting of rights according to this section 13.1 to 13.3 shall not apply to the third party software components listed in the software chart in the price sheet (section 2.1.4). The rights to which EIT RawMaterials is entitled in respect of these software components are set out in the price sheet (section 2.1.4).
13.6 The transfer of rights to the work results is covered by the payment of the agreed remuneration according to section 7.
